Abstract

This disclosure relates to a kind of form templat storage method, device, storage medium and electronic equipment, the form templat storage method includes: the control information obtained in forms pages, and based on the control information and control model library in the forms pages, generate the target entity model of the corresponding forms pages, wherein, the control model library includes the corresponding relationship of control information and physical model;It is the corresponding field information of the target database by the target entity model conversion according to the field type transformation rule of target database;According to the field information, the database table for characterizing the form templat of the forms pages is established in the target database.By the technical solution of the disclosure, may be implemented to automatically create form templat based on forms pages, compared with the prior art in form templat established by manual type, improve efficiency, save human cost.

In order to make those skilled in the art be easier to understand the technical solution of embodiment of the present disclosure offer, first to this public affairs The related notion being related to is opened simply to be introduced.
Forms pages are common a kind of metadata acquisition tools in Web page, and user can be by forms pages to Web page Fill in and submit data.
Control is that user interacts to input or the object of operation data, and a forms pages generally include a variety of controls Part, such as single file text control, multiline text control, date control, check box control and radio box control etc..
It may include the database table of the corresponding data for storing each control in the forms pages in database.It should It may include many fields in database table, each field can correspond to the data of one control of storage.
The embodiment of the present disclosure provides a kind of form templat storage method, is that the embodiment of the present disclosure provides referring to Fig. 1, Fig. 1 A kind of form templat storage method flow chart, method includes the following steps:
In step s 11, the control information in forms pages is obtained, and based on the control information and control in forms pages Part model library generates the target entity model of corresponding forms pages, wherein control model library includes control information and physical model Corresponding relationship.
Wherein, physical model is a kind of number for describing the corresponding relationship between control information and Database field information According to structure, play the role of connecting forms pages and database.Control information includes the title of each control, type etc., data The field information in library includes field name, field identification, the field length, field type of the corresponding field for storing each control data It and whether is required item etc..Table 1 shows the corresponding relationship between a kind of control information and Database field information.
Specifically, the source code of forms pages is traversed, the control information of all controls in the forms pages can be obtained.For Each control obtains the corresponding entity of the control according to the corresponding relationship of control information and physical model in control model library Model.It is associated in this way, being provided between control and database on list.

It in step s 12, is target by target entity model conversion according to the field type transformation rule of target database The corresponding field information of database.
Since same field information has different type definition modes in different databases, thus in target data It is established before database table in library, need to be according to the field type transformation rule of target database, the field that physical model is described Type is converted to the field type for adapting to target database.Table 2 shows a kind of field type conversion rule of Mysql database Then, table 3 shows a kind of field type transformation rule of oracle database.
Specifically, there are the field type transformation rules of multitype database in database template library, by inquiring database Template library can obtain the field type transformation rule of target database.
Table 2
The field type of physical model description The corresponding field type of Mysql database
String VARchar
Date DATETIME
Integer INT
Float Float()
Clob TEXT
…… ……
Table 3
The field type of physical model description The corresponding field type of oracle database
String VARchar2
Date DATE
Integer NUMBER
Float NUMBER()
Clob CLOB
…… ……

In another embodiment of the disclosure, it is contemplated that different databases has the field type in database table Different rules, thus in target database before the database table of form templat of the foundation for characterizing forms pages, it is first First whether judgement meets the field type of target database by the field information that transformation rule switch target physical model obtains Rule carries out differentiation processing to field information if the field information does not meet the field type rule of target database.
Illustratively, the field type rule of Mysql database is that the field of all variable length character VARCHAR types is long Degree is no more than the maximum length 65535 allowed, therefore, in the field letter obtained by transformation rule switch target physical model After breath, settable one threshold value less than 65535, the field that judgement passes through variable length character VARCHAR type in the field information Whether length is greater than or equal to preset threshold, if the field length of the variable length character VARCHAR type is more than or equal to described Preset threshold, it is believed that the field length of the elongated character VARCHAR type is close to 65535, then by the variable length character VARCHAR Type Change is text TEXT type, it may be assumed that
Mysql:
If(columns.size>65535){
Max(column).to(Clob)
}
